Subject: Key rotation — webhook retry service

Team: rotating the Fennelgate delivery key before Thursday's sync. Reminder on retry semantics: exponential backoff, max five attempts, then dead-letter to the Quillbin queue. Consumers must dedupe on delivery ID since retries aren't idempotent on our side. Old key dies Friday 0900. Update your local configs now. New key for the Fennelgate dispatcher follows below.

gateway credential: kto7_GoY89Me

## Further Reading

If you're building plugins for TideGlance, start with the sections above, then poke around the examples repo maintained by the Harborline team. The moon-phase offsets and datum conversions trip everyone up at first, so don't feel bad. For the full spec on widget lifecycle hooks, station codes, and theming, see our internal reference page here:

operations page: https://jenkins.zemvarcloud.local/job/merge_requests/repo/build/73930b4b30f0a8ed

**Q: My plugin fails validation against the Lintfall baseline file — what now?**

A: The baseline pins known findings so new plugin releases only surface new issues. Don't edit it by hand; run the regenerate command from a clean checkout. If regeneration asks to unlock the signed baseline store, supply the recovery passphrase below.

unlock words, kagef-taduf: fenir-quenix-norwyn-sorvan-gormir-gorir-fraok

= Annual Billing Transition (Managers Only) =

This page documents the shift of Lumera Suite subscriptions from monthly to annual billing. Finance should note: deferred revenue recognition changes take effect from Q2, and the collections calendar compresses into two peak windows. Proration rules for mid-cycle upgrades are in the appendix. Discount ceiling for annual commitment is 14%. Do not share externally. The underlying strategic reasoning appears below.

internal memo for kawip-hadug: Headcount on the Wenwyn team goes from 7 to 140 by the end of January. Gross margin on Wenwyn came in at 20 percent against a plan of 15 percent.